I am a board-certified psychiatrist specializing in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D). I have over 10 years of experience using prazosin and doxazosin to treat PTSD related nightmares and flashbacks. My passion is raising awareness of this and helping people know that there is an effective treatment for this that they may not have heard of. I focus on treating flashbacks and nightmares with prazosin and doxazosin.
